The World Jones Made is set in a post-apocalyptic future where Earth is governed by a Federal World Government (Fedgov) following the collapse of major nations after a devastating nuclear war. Laws are based on a political orthodoxy known as “Relativism,” which says that people can believe whatever they want as long they don’t push those beliefs on others. Recreational sex and drug consumption are also endorsed by law. Dissidents of Relativism are sent to labor camps. Floyd Jones, a charismatic precog with the ability to see up to one year into the future, rises to power and overthrows Fedgov to become a world dictator. Fun and entertaining early PKD novel that explores questions of predestination and free will.
